<p>Understanding How Double Glazing Works</p>

<hr>

<p>Before diving into repair work, it helps to comprehend what makes a double-glazed window special. Unlike single-pane glass, double-glazed windows consist of two glass panes separated by a spacer bar. This space is usually filled with an inert gas— such as argon— and sealed securely at the edges.</p>

<p>The main job of this sealed system (frequently called an IGU, or Insulated Glass Unit) is to create a thermal barrier. When this seal stops working, or when physical components like hinges and deals with wear, the window&#39;s efficiency drops.</p>
<ul><li>* *</li></ul>

<p>Typical Signs Your Double Glazing Needs Repair</p>

<hr>

<p>Double glazing problems seldom happen overnight. They normally manifest through subtle indications that gradually worsen. Here are the most typical indications that a window requires attention:</p>
<ul><li><strong>Condensation Between the Panes:</strong> This is the dead giveaway of a damaged window seal. Once the seal stops working, moisture-laden air goes into the cavity, fogging the glass from the within where it can not be wiped away.</li>
<li><strong>Drafts Around the Frame:</strong> If cold air is leaking in even when the window is securely shut, the window gaskets or seals have degraded.</li>
<li><strong>Problem Opening and Closing:</strong> Warped frames, misaligned sashes, or rusted hardware can make running the window a discouraging physical chore.</li>
<li><strong>Increased Outside Noise:</strong> If the street sound suddenly appears louder, the acoustic insulation properties of the double glazing have actually likely been jeopardized.</li>
<li><strong>Noticeable Damage:</strong> Cracks, chips, or shattered glass undoubtedly need immediate professional intervention.</li>

<li><p><strong>Water Leaks:</strong> Pooling water on the interior windowsill during heavy rain indicates poor exterior sealing or obstructed drainage channels.</p></li>

<p>Deep Dive Into Specific Double Glazing Repairs</p>

<hr>

<h3 id="1-repairing-misted-windows" id="1-repairing-misted-windows">1. Repairing Misted Windows</h3>

<p>Misted glass is the most frequent call-out for window repair professionals. <a href="https://www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k/dartford-misted-double-glazing-repairs-near-me/">Full Review</a> to popular belief, you can not simply “clean” the inside of the panes. The whole sealed unit must be removed.</p>
<ul><li><strong>The Process:</strong> An expert glazier eliminates the glazing beads holding the glass in place, measures the frame, orders a custom-made replacement IGU, and fits it into the existing frame. The surrounding frame remains completely undamaged.</li></ul>

<h3 id="2-resolving-faulty-hinges-and-handles" id="2-resolving-faulty-hinges-and-handles">2. Resolving Faulty Hinges and Handles</h3>

<p>Over years of usage, friction stays (hinges) can bend, and deals with can remove their internal systems.</p>
<ul><li><strong>The Process:</strong> Window service technicians carry a vast array of generic and brand-specific replacement hardware. Swapping out a broken espag manage or drooping hinge generally takes less than an hour and brings back the window&#39;s security and airtight seal.</li></ul>

<h3 id="3-draft-exclusion-and-gasket-replacement" id="3-draft-exclusion-and-gasket-replacement">3. Draft Exclusion and Gasket Replacement</h3>

<p>Rubber gaskets act as the weatherproofing shield around the edges of the glass and opening sashes. With time, UV direct exposure causes this rubber to dry, shrink, and crack.</p>
<ul><li><p><strong>The Process:</strong> Old, broken down gaskets are peeled away from the tracks, and a fresh, versatile rubber or silicone seal is fed into the channel. This quickly gets rid of drafts and brings back energy performance.</p></li>

<p>Can You DIY Double Glazing Repairs?</p>

<hr>

<p>While minor jobs— like lubricating hinges with 3-in-1 oil, tightening up loose deal with screws, or applying short-term outside silicone caulk— are well within the world of DIY, most double-glazing repair work require expert proficiency.</p>

<p>Factors to leave it to the pros consist of:</p>
<ul><li><strong>Safety Risks:</strong> Handling big panes of glass without appropriate suction tools and protective gear can result in severe injury.</li>
<li><strong>Specialized Measurements:</strong> Insulated glass units should be made to millimeter-precise measurements. A mismeasurement indicates the new unit will not fit.</li>

<li><p><strong>Warranty Protection:</strong> Many double-glazed windows come with manufacturer guarantees that become void if unapproved modifications or repairs are tried.</p></li>
